双重可调式轨道基础研究与设计

摘    要:自动化轨道吊由于行驶速度远超港区普通轨道吊,因此其运行精度要求及标准较高。需研究如何根据实际情况选择可行、可靠、经济的轨道基础结构形式并合理确定相关参数。通过比选目前常用轨道基础形式,结合洋山工程实例及有限元数值模拟,提出了一种不设桩基的新基础形式——双重可调式轨道基础,并完善了其结构及构造设计,基本解决了沉降易发地基上不设桩基的轨道吊设备安全高效运行问题。

关 键 词:双重可调  轨道基础  可调支座系统  变形协调

Research and design on dually adjustable track foundation

Abstract:The requirements and standards of automation gantry crane running accuracy are very high because the rate of it is much faster than ordinary gantry crane.Researches are requested on how to choose the feasible,reliable and economical form of track foundation and how to choose reasonably the relevant parameters based on the actual situation.By comparison of the current common form of track foundation,with examples and finite element numerical simulation of Yangshan project,a new track foundation type is proposed,dual adjustable track foundation.In the meantime its structure and configuration design is improved.Based on the above researches,the problem of safe and efficient operation of gantry crane without pile foundation on the subsidence prone ground is basically solved.
Keywords:dually adjustable  track foundation  adjustable bearing  deformation compatibility
